It wouldn't surprise me in the slightest if they bring back Blofeld and then kill him off either immediately in Spectre or in the next film or two. They're very lucky to regain the rights to use the character and it would just fit the destructive, short term, spectacle[sup]1[/sup] at any cost nature of modern film to blow those rights in no time at all. It's like where they bring back the DB5 only for it to be destroyed or in the later Trek films the Enterprises repeatedly being wrecked in questionable circumstances just to create a spectacle. Modern film making is all about throwing everything and the kitchen sink into the next film, sucking everything good out of a franchise until it is dry and trashing it all just to try and make it more exciting or edgy. They don't care what it does for future continuity because they can always just reboot or remake. Again.
I always thought it would be good to bring Blofeld back in a way that maintains the continuity with FYEO, like there was water in the chimney and his chair broke the fall, or even that was yet another double with the real Blofeld watching remotely. It's not going to happen though because I think as far as Babs is concerned FYEO might as well have never happened.
